[Solved] Edge icon not showing

Hello,

When I open MS Edge the icon that shows is not edge's.

Image

Edge is NOT pinned to taskbar, I tried pinning edge's shortcut from the start menu folder but it opens on a separate icon. It happened since I performed a system restore.

Method 1: Check for Microsoft Edge Update

1. Open Microsoft Edge and click the three (3) dots on the upper right corner
2. Select Help and feedback on the lower part
3. Select About Microsoft Edge
4. It will automatically check for available updates, install available updates then restart your computer and check if it resolves your concern

Method 2: Perform Clean Boot
- This process will eliminate 3rd party application running in the background of your computer along with services that are not needed to run windows. If there's any conflicting 3rd party application that causes the issue on your computer, this process will stop it.

1. Open the run box by pressing the Windows Key + R and type msconfig
2. System Configuration Utility box will open and by default you are on general tab.
3. On the General tab, click the selective startup and make sure that load system service and load startup items both have checked mark.
4. Click on services tab
5. Put a check mark on Hide All Microsoft Services > This is a very important part as if you miss to click on this, computer might not boot properly or permanently and will end up on clean installation.
6. Once Hide all Microsoft Services have checked mark on it, click on Disable All
7. Click on the Startup Tab and click open task manager. This will open another window which contains all your startup applications on the administrator account.
8. Disable all application that you're not using. You can simply just click on them and select disable.
9. Click OK , Apply and close the configuration utility.
